Impact
The change of a stock symbol in and of itself has no specific value or meaning. A change may have little consequence to anyone. Changes frequently occur among companies newer to stock exchanges. This also occurs if a company wants trying to find a symbol that has better distinction and name recognition. Changes don't usually disturb trades or markets.
Investors
Like names themselves, stock symbols can affect the way investors view a company. Share prices are largely a reflection of investor perceptions about a company; a changing symbol can be a small part of a larger change in a company. For example, a merger usually leads to the acquired company dropping its stock symbol in favor of the purchaser's.
